Analysis
Viet Nam recorded 0.6% for repetition rate in grade 3 of primary education, both sexes in 2014. That is the lowest value across all 9 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 6.8% on the previous year and down 65.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, repetition rate in grade 3 of primary education, both sexes in Viet Nam peaked at 5.3% in 1978 and was at its lowest, 0.6%, in 2014.
That places Viet Nam 118th out of 179 countries with data for 2014, putting it in the middle of the range.

About this data
Number of repeaters in a given grade in a given school year, expressed as a percentage of enrolment in that grade the previous school year. Divide the number of repeaters in a given grade in school year t+1 by the number of pupils from the same cohort enrolled in the same grade in the previous school year t.
